IN THE PLANNING CO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F PLEASANTON <br />COUNTY OF ALAM6DA, STATE OF CALIFORNIA <br />Minutes <br />March 16, 1961 <br />Vice-Chairman Landon called the meeting to order at 8:25 p. m. <br />As there was no quorum present, Secretary Falea presented matters for <br />discussion that would require no action. He outlined his prepared "Statement <br />of Community Goals in Relation to an Expanded General Plan". <br />Upon arrival oY Commissioner Allison, at 8:35 p. m., Roll Call was ordered. <br />ROLL CALL: Present - Commissioners Allison, Landon, and Lozano <br />Ex-0fficio Commissioners Hohn and King <br />Absent -.Commissioners Hanifen and Mitchell <br />~c-0fficio Commissioners Dana and Kamp <br />On motion of Commissioner Lozano, seconded by Commissioner Allison, and <br />approved by all Commissioners present, the minutes of the March 2, 1961 meeting <br />were approved as forwarded. <br />Public Hearing was held on the application of Frank Auf der Maur for a <br />Variance from Section 6.5 of Ordinance No. 309 for the property located at <br />4436 Mirador Drive. Secretary Falea recommended that the Variance be granted, <br />inasmuch as there would be no gross violation of the Zoning Ordinance. <br />Mr. Stover, owner of adjacent property, offered no objection to the Variance <br />request.
